taking things seriously
by joshua glenn and carol hayes
photographs and stories about small and odd things that have value and significance, like found objects, relics, and scraps. it made me look around my apartment and think about the odd little things that i cherish.

hand job, a catalog of type
by michael perry
a collection of typography made by hand rather than the computer. also great photos of artists studios and type inspiration.
